The sports betting industry is growing and you really need an outstanding sports betting app to differentiate your business from the market. A good app will have all the key features, a smooth user experience, and backend development that can handle all the essentials. Here are the steps to produce an app to engage users and deliver overall success to your business.
What is a sports betting app?
A sports betting app is a mobile app that lets people bet on sports like football, cricket, or basketball. Users can see live scores, check odds, and place bets directly from their phones. These apps are easy to use and allow users to bet anytime and anywhere, making the whole process fast, fun, and convenient.
Key Features for a High-Performance Sports Betting App
To keep users happy and engaged, your app needs to have certain features:
Real-Time Data & Odds
Users want to bet during live games, so your app needs real-time scores and live odds. You can get this information through an API from third- party providers.
Safe Payment Options
Betting involves real money and therefore it is very important that it be safe. Let users pay through different payment forms, cards, e-wallets, cryptocurrencies, etc. Also, make sure all transactions are encrypted so users stay safe and their personal data is protected.
Simple, Easy-to-Use Interface
Your app must be easy to use. Users should quickly and effortlessly navigate the app to find their favorite sports, check the latest odds, place bets, and handle their account settings with ease.
Different Betting Options
The more options for users to bet, the better. Offer many betting markets. Odds to win a match, scores, over/under bets, the more range of bets you have, the better experience users will have when using your app.
Live Streaming
If you can, provide live streams of games. This keeps users interested and helps them place smarter, more informed bets. However, you’ll need the proper licenses for this.
Bonuses & Promotions
Bonuses are exciting! Welcome bonuses, free bets, and loyalty rewards are powerful tools to attract new users and keep existing ones coming back.
Responsible Gambling Tools
Include any responsible gambling features, like limits on bet amounts, or players taking a timeout. This builds trust and can also help meet compliance with regulations in many, many jurisdictions.
Technology stack for Building a High-Performance App
To successfully develop an app, you must select the correct technology. Here is the technology you will need:
Mobile Frameworks
To ensure compatibility with both iOS and Android, frameworks such as React Native or Flutter can help build apps for each platform without creating separate projects.
Cloud Hosting
Use cloud services (like AWS or Google Cloud) to store data and ensure your app runs smoothly even as more users join.
APIs
APIs will be used to pull live data for games, odds, and also for user authentication. Ensure you are connecting to good APIs to supply quick, reliable, and updated information.
Databases
You will need a database that has the ability to store user data and betting history, etc. Depending on your preferences, either MySQL or MongoDB can be leveraged as a database.
Ensuring Security and Compliance
Protecting your users’ data and money is important:
Data Encryption
Encrypt data both in storage and while it’s being transferred over the internet.
Secure Logins
Make use of features such as multi-factor authentication to allow users to log in securely so their accounts are safe.
Follow the Law
Sports betting is regulated in many countries, so make sure your app follows local laws and gets the necessary licenses.
User Acquisition and Marketing
Building a great app is just the beginning. To grow your business, you also need to attract and keep users.
- Utilize social media, search engine optimization (SEO), and advertisements to effectively reach your target users.
- Consider approaching sports teams or other influencers to promote your application.
Final thoughts :
To create a successful sports betting app, you will need to provide real-time data, secure deposits and withdrawals, an easy-to-navigate user interface, and features for responsible . Properly marry technology and design with smart marketing to gain users and continue building the app. Your app will need ongoing developments and improvement to stay competitive and best chance for long-term success.
Why Choose Bidbits for Sports Betting App Development?
Bidbits builds powerful and easy-to-use sports betting apps for businesses. We help startups and growing companies launch apps that are secure, full of useful features, and ready to grow. With Bidbits, you get a reliable partner who understands the betting industry and delivers solutions that follow all the rules and stand out from the competition.